What’s in the news

Chris Ashton edged closer to playing for England once again after being named in the 44-man training squad. The wing was ineligible when plying his trade over in Toulon but has returned to the Premiership, joining Sale Sharks.

In Super Rugby, the Crusaders and Lions have named their teams for the showpiece event, with both sides largely keeping faith with the squads that won their respective semi-finals.
